It’s been several generations of soccer players ago, since the men’s Hungarian national team has been a force on the world stage. Back in the early days on international competition, Hungary were one of the top teams, buoyed by two runner up finishes at World Cups, winning three Olympic gold medals, and finishing in third at the 1964 European Championships.

But until last summer’s European Championship, Hungary had not played at a major international for 30 years. So it was surprising when Hungary topped a group with Portugal, the also surprising Iceland, and Austria. Hungary eventually bowed in the Round of 16 to Belgium, but their return to the international stage was a welcomed sight for Hungary.
